summaryrefslogtreecommitdiffstats
path: root/drivers/gpio
diff options
context:
space:
mode:
authorWilliam Breathitt Gray <vilhelm.gray@gmail.com>2017-01-30 09:39:37 -0500
committerLinus Walleij <linus.walleij@linaro.org>2017-02-01 15:59:18 +0100
commit3547f1405d0346d5c10c377762a70b7090f8ed7b (patch)
tree10538f05546c3c1ffd87e0af1a97151910b270ad /drivers/gpio
parent3988d663c02fc050afddb78953e8b0cad83e9905 (diff)
downloadlinux-3547f1405d0346d5c10c377762a70b7090f8ed7b.tar.bz2
gpio: 104-dio-48e: Remove unnecessary driver_data set
Setting driver_data was necessary to access private data in the dio48e_remove function. Now that the dio48e_remove function is gone, driver_data is no longer used. This patch removes the relevant code. Signed-off-by: William Breathitt Gray <vilhelm.gray@gmail.com>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Diffstat (limited to 'drivers/gpio')
-rw-r--r--drivers/gpio/gpio-104-dio-48e.c2
1 files changed, 0 insertions, 2 deletions
diff --git a/drivers/gpio/gpio-104-dio-48e.c b/drivers/gpio/gpio-104-dio-48e.c
index 221243f17d4e..b6b0378166c4 100644
--- a/drivers/gpio/gpio-104-dio-48e.c
+++ b/drivers/gpio/gpio-104-dio-48e.c
@@ -369,8 +369,6 @@ static int dio48e_probe(struct device *dev, unsigned int id)
spin_lock_init(&dio48egpio->lock);
- dev_set_drvdata(dev, dio48egpio);
-
err = devm_gpiochip_add_data(dev, &dio48egpio->chip, dio48egpio);
if (err) {
dev_err(dev, "GPIO registering failed (%d)\n", err);